What is the difference between Yakhni Pulao and pulao? ›

Yakhni Pulao vs Non-Yakhni Pulao

Yakhni just means broth or stock. So Yakhni Pulao is made by simmering bone-in meat to create a broth, which is then used to cook the rice. Without Yakhni, Pulao is a one-pot meal cooked in aromatics, protein or vegetables, whole spices, and water.

What are the different types of yakhni? ›

In Pakistan and India, yakhni refers to stock or broth of beef, chicken, lamb or mutton. It is touted for its health benefits and is often the base for many foods including pulao (a pilaf) and other shorbas (soups). In Bangladesh, akhni is a mixed rice dish and variant of the biryani and polao dishes.

Who invented Yakhni Pulao? ›

The origins of Yakhni Pulao lie apparently in Persia and it was introduced to us Indians by the Mughal rulers. Yakhni basically is a yogurt saffron based mutton broth. The broth/ stock is made using mutton and aromatics aka whole garam masala which is tied in a bouquet garni.

What is yakhni in Persian? ›

Yakhni in Persian is a meat stew, soup or broth and is often used as an energizing soup in winters or as a base for many other dishes.

Which is the famous pulao of Pakistan? ›

Degi chana pulao is a very famous Pakistani dish usually served at gatherings or distributed during the holy months of Muharram and Ramadan. Pulao is a Pakistani rice dish made with long-grain basmati rice and yakhni, caramelized onions, meat, chicken, or any other vegetables of your choice.
